Raidar 6.5 won't launch on Mac with M1 Apple Silicon
When I try to run the current version of raidar I find at https://kb.netgear.com/20684/ReadyNAS-Downloads#raidar it fails on my MacBook pro M1 running macOS Ventura (13.0.1) I want to connect to my ReadyNAS 628 which I bought on 9/09/2020 so a bit more than 2 years ago. I see that it appears to have been end of life on 2/1/2021 just a few months after I bought it!
Is raidar actually dead for Mac M1 Users?

Re: Raidar 6.5 won't launch on Mac with M1 Apple Silicon
You would need Rosetta and Java installed to run RAIDar. It runs for me, but I upgraded from a previous version of OS X. Whilst RAIDar is a useful discovery tool, you do not need RAIDar to use the device.
You can view the IP address on the display on the RN628
